Body

Origins and Family

Hugh Bromley-Davenport's place of birth was Capesthorne Hall[2]. He was born on +1870-08-18T00:00:00Z[3]. His father was William Bromley-Davenport[8]. His mother was Augusta Campbell[9].

Education

Educated at Eton College[14], a public school[28], in United Kingdom[29], founded in 1440[30] and Trinity Hall[15], a university building[31], in United Kingdom[32], founded in 1350[33], headquartered in Cambridge[34].

Career and Affiliations

Hugh Bromley-Davenport worked as a cricketer[6].

Recognition

Hugh Bromley-Davenport received the Officer of the Order of the British Empire[16].

Personal Life

Among Hugh Bromley-Davenport's spouses was Muriel Comber Head[10]. A child of him was Richard Anthony Bromley Davenport[11].

Death and Burial

Hugh Bromley-Davenport died on +1954-05-23T00:00:00Z[5]. He passed away in South Kensington[4].
